A guide to uninstall News Plugin 3.2 from your PC

News Plugin 3.2 is a computer program. This page is comprised of details on how to uninstall it from your computer. It was developed for Windows by Open E Cry, LLC. More data about Open E Cry, LLC can be read here. More information about News Plugin 3.2 can be seen at . The program is usually installed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\dt Pro\Plugins directory (same installation drive as Windows). "C:\Program Files (x86)\dt Pro\Plugins\unins000.exe" is the full command line if you want to uninstall News Plugin 3.2. The application's main executable file has a size of 653.26 KB (668938 bytes) on disk and is called unins000.exe.

News Plugin 3.2 installs the following the executables on your PC, taking about 653.26 KB (668938 bytes) on disk.

  • unins000.exe (653.26 KB)


The current web page applies to News Plugin 3.2 version 3.2 only.
